# Write Reviews

Draft or submit Amazon product reviews from purchased items.

## Requirements Gate

Before drafting or browser automation, ask directly for any missing review inputs:

- Product or order to review
- Rating or sentiment
- Main pros, cons, use case, and time used
- Whether the user wants a draft only or wants help submitting after review

If the user already supplied enough inputs, proceed.

## Browser Access

Use the normal signed-in browser surface available in the current environment when verifying purchased-item context or opening the Amazon review form.

## Workflow

1. Identify the product or order being reviewed.
2. Verify purchase context when possible from the product page, order history, or review form.
3. Draft a concise, specific review grounded in the user's experience.
4. If the user wants submission help, place the draft in the review form and stop for explicit approval before submitting.
5. Submit only after the user confirms the final visible review content and rating.

Review forms may start from a product page or order details and may require stars, title, body, media, or feature ratings. Keep drafts grounded in the user's actual experience; do not invent usage or make medical/legal guarantees. Fill only approved content, stop before final submission unless already approved, verify the thank-you/submitted state after submission, and report sign-in or non-reviewable blockers.

## Account Actions

Do not submit, edit, or delete a review unless the user explicitly approves that exact action after seeing the final content. Drafting is allowed without submission approval.

## Output Rules

- For drafts, provide the review text and a suggested star rating if requested.
- For browser-assisted submissions, report whether the review was drafted, submitted, or blocked.
- After approved submission, verify the final submitted or thank-you state before saying it was submitted.
